    "Dea. Isaac Sheldon s of Isaac & Sarah (Warner) born Aug 26, 1686 died 1749 ae 63 bur Center Ch mar/1 Feb 29, 1716-7 (Hartford Town Record) Elizabeth Pratt born Aug 19, 1693 (Hartford Town Record) bp Aug 20, 1693 (1 Ch Rec) died 1745 ae 53 bur Center Ch dau of Daniel Pratt and Elizabeth Lee. Mar/2 prob Theodora Hunt of North?. She was born Nov 22, 1694 dau of Jonathan Hunt and Martha (Williams).

    "Probate Records. Vol. XV, 1745 to 1750. Page 308-9-10.

    Sheldon, Isaac, Hartford. Will dated 11 November, 1746: I, Isaac Sheldon of Hartford, do make this my last will and testament: I give to my wife Theoda the use and improvement of my northeast room, the middle chamber of the dwelling house wherein I now live, and the privilege in the kitchen and well belonging to the house, sufficient for her necessary household work; also the use of 1-3 part of my garden and the privilege in my barn and yard sufficient for the keeping of one or two cows for her use; only not to lease or farm-let to any other, and only during the time she remains my widow. And whereas, at the time of marriage with my sd. wife I received many valuable goods and household stuff with her, for which I gave a receipt to her mother, Mrs. Martha Hunt of Northampton, therein obliging myself and my heirs to return the same at my decease or at the decease of my wife, the wearing excepted, my will therefore is that all these goods mentioned in sd. receipt he returned accordingly immediately after my decease. And further, I give unto my sd. wife all other goods and chattells which she brought to me or that was hers at the time of our marriage, of what kind soever, they to be to her own use forever. And furthermore, provided my wife shall acquit and discharge my executor hereafter named from all claims of her right of dowry or thirds in my estate, that she may or can have thereunto, then my will is that my executors shall in equal proportion pay unto my sd. wife annually £20 money at the rate of 40 shillings per ounce, Troy weight, sterling alloy, during the whole time she shall continue my widow. To my daughter Elizabeth Marsh I give, besides what I have already given her, my homelott in New Hartford (50 acres more or less), to her and her heirs forever. Also, I give unto my daughter Elizabeth £60, to be paid in old tenor bills of credit or in moveables out of my estate equal to silver at the rate of 40 shillings per ounce, to be paid to her within seven years after my decease. Also, I give unto my daughter Elizabeth 20 sheep. To my daughter Sarah Woodbridge I give the sum of £200 besides what I have already given her, to be paid in bills of old tenor or in moveables equal to silver at the rate of 40 shillings per ounce. I give to my youngest daughters, Rebeckah and Hannah Sheldon, £800 apiece, to be paid to each of them in bills of credit in the old tenor or in moveables equal to silver at the rate of 40 shillings per ounce. I give unto my son Isaac Sheldon my dwelling house wherein I now dwell, barn and other buildings, and all that platt or piece of land whereon the sd. buildings are erected, about 5 roods more or less, butting west on a highway, north on the Little River, south on Thomas Welles's land, and extends east as far as the east side of Thomas Welles's land. I give to my three sons, Isaac, Daniel and Joseph Sheldon, besides what I have severally given and done for them, all my estate, both real and personal, not already disposed of, after my lawfull debts, legacies and funeral charges are paid, viz., all my land and right of land in the Townships of Hartford, New Hartford and Colebrook, and my iron works and lands in the Townships of Canaan and Salisbury, all my lands and rights in the Township of Union, in the County of Windham, and at Northampton, in Hampshire County, and all other my lands and rights, whether divided or undivided; also all my moveable estate, as implements of husbandry, stock of cattle, horses, sheep and swine, and all other my goods, cattle and credits, wheresoever they may be found, they paying the above-named legacies, debts and funeral expenses, to be holden equally between them. I appoint my three sons, Daniel, Isaac and Joseph, to be my executors.

    ISAAC SHELDON, LS.

    Witness: Ann X Buckingham, J: Buckingham, Joseph Olcott.

    Court Record, Page 99—2 May, 1749: The last will and testament of Deacon Isaac Sheldon was now exhibited in Court by Isaac Sheldon and Joseph Sheldon, executors named in sd. will. Will proven. Ordered recorded and kept on file.

    Page 115—30 January, 1749-50: Isaac, Daniel and Joseph Sheldon, executors and heirs to the estate of Isaac Sheldon, late of Hartford, now move for distribution of the moveable estate: Whereupon this Court appoint Thomas Welles and Ozias Goodwin distributors."
